DERMALOGIC Towel Steamer 120

The Dermalogic Towel Steamer 120 is built for Professional use in Massage Spa Centers, Barbershops, Beauty salons, and Nail Salons. This towel steamer fits 120 towels at a time to sanitize them all at once and have them ready for full-body wraps, massages, facials, and other services. You can also do smaller loads to have warm towels when you need them for specific appointments. You can heat the towels from 90 to 200 degrees Fahrenheit. The automatic shut-off feature keeps this machine safe, while sanitized towels allow you to follow health and safety standards. Plus, this steamer holds plenty of water at once and lights up when you need a refill. Three shelves help you maximize space and a clear window allows you to check on the towels. The unit stands 18 inches long by 16 inches wide by 27 inches high. This steamer is perfect for medium to large-sized salons and spas.

This hot towel steamer can also be used to steam and warm massage rocks and implements in addition to towels if so desired. The Dermalogic brand has grown to become one of the most well-known in the salon facial and skin treatment equipment industry and for good reason. 

Details/Dimensions

  • Large water reservoir (1.35 gallon)
  • Auto shut-off feature for safety and to save energy
  • Insulated walls to improve energy efficiency
  • The water refill indicator light
  • Durable stainless-steel construction
  • Inside DIM: Length: 14.5" Width: 13" Height: 20.5"
  • Outside DIM: Length: 17" Width: 17.75" Height: 26.75"
  • Adjustable temperature from 90° F - 200° F
  • Made in Taiwan
